Abstract: | Subcooled boiling has been subject of extensive research studies in the literature. So far, the approach of studying the phenomena
of subcooled boiling has rather been an integral method by measuring the heat transport from the wall to the liquid and by
following the growth and collapse of the bubbles. However, little is known about the heat transport at the phase interface
between the surface of the bubbles and the subcooled liquid. Experimental attempts to study the transport phenomena around
the bubble surface quantitatively have been performed by using the holographic interferometry, an optical method, which works
in an inertialess and non-invasive way. The conventional holographic interferometry has somewhat been modified by applying
the finite fringe method. With this technique interesting insights could be gained and precise quantitative data could be
evaluated. |
